Exploring The Beauty Of Marble Countertops

Marble countertops are some of the most beautiful and attractive ones money can buy today. This natural stone has a specific beauty due to mother nature’s affects over centuries.

Specialists say that there are no 2 identical marble tiles in the world, so if you go with this product, your kitchen will always look unique. One of the most beautiful aspects of marble consists of its rich veining. This process took place as a result of hundreds of years of pressure and heat in the belly of the Earth.

Another benefit of marble countertops is that they tend to look increasingly more beautiful with age. Marble tends to get darker as the years pass, but this will not take away from its characteristic beauty and elegant design.

However, marble doesn’t come without its disadvantages. It’s a porous material, meaning that it’s susceptible to mold and mildew. You can go around this problem by sealing the surface of the marble and making it more resistant to chemicals, heat, moisture, foods, and beverages.

Marble is also slightly more expensive than other materials. You’ll need a larger budget if you want to renovate your bathroom, kitchen or both. Still, marble countertops have a tremendous return on investment, and experts agree that marble countertops increase the value of your house!

Navigating The Durability Of Quartz Countertops

Quartz is another popular material for kitchen or bathroom countertops. That’s because it has numerous advantages and it comes at an affordable price. Although quartz is not a natural stone and doesn’t score the highest marks when it comes to beauty and design, it’s a practical material that can take decades of heavy use.

For example, one of the biggest advantages of quartz is its heat and scratch resistance. You can put hot pans over quartz countertops, they won’t be damaged by the heat. It’s also almost impossible to scratch quartz countertops and it’s stain-resistant too. Spilling wine or juice on your quartz products won’t take away from their pleasant design.

Homeowners also appreciate the fact that quartz countertops require little to no maintenance. These are non-porous items, so they don’t absorb moisture and don’t facilitate the development of mold and mildew.

Quartz countertops are usually made from a combination of crushed quartz and resins. Experts also add different colors to the mixture to create quartz countertops in various designs. These items don’t have the “veiny” look of marble, but they look great in any bathroom or kitchen, not to mention that they are more affordable.

Getting Acquainted with Granite Countertops

The last ones on our list are granite countertops.

The advantages of granite are numerous. This material is heat and scratch-resistant, so it cannot be damaged that easily. It’s also resistant to harsh chemicals and stains, so spilling a glass of wine on your granite countertops won’t damage their design.

Granite is also available in a plethora of colors. You can go for lighter or darker nuances, depending on your preferences and needs. Granite countertops look great and have an eye-catching, abstract design, but they are not as elegant and luxurious as marble. Still, a lot of homeowners prefer it over other materials because granite is affordable and requires little to no maintenance.

With that being said, it’s important to mention that granite is a porous material, so when using granite, it’s important to have high-grade sealing to preserve its beauty. Sealing your granite countertops doesn’t cost a lot of money and it prevents the development of mold and mildew on their surface. Sealing the surface of the granite countertops protects them from spills, chemicals or stains as well.
